Graham explained that these warming events are related to the decline of winter sea ice in the Arctic, noting that January's ice extent was the lowest on record. "As the sea ice is melting and thinning, it is becoming more vulnerable to these winter storms," he explained. "The thinner ice drifts more quickly and can break up into smaller pieces. The strong winds from the south can push the ice further north into the Central Arctic, exposing the open water and releasing heat to the atmosphere from the ocean."
Scientists were shocked in recent days to discover open water north of Greenland, an area normally covered by old, very thick ice. "This has me more worried than the warm temps in the Arctic right now," tweeted Mike MacFerrin, an ice sheet specialist at the University of Colorado.
